Katherine and Nick’s love story is a testament to fate and patience. Despite only having one date after meeting on a blind date, they did not forget each other, leading Nick to find a clever inroad through Katherine’s very special boy, her dog Blue, years later.  This time, there was a spark that blossomed into a love story and a stunning Ritz Carlton Laguna Niguel wedding celebration that reflected their love, values, and connection.

As their wedding planner, it was an honor to collaborate closely with Katherine and her mom to curate a day that honored their Catholic faith while infusing it with timeless elegance and vibrant energy. The choice of the Mission Basilica in San Juan Capistrano set the stage for their traditional ceremony and mass, while the Ritz Carlton Laguna Niguel provided the perfect backdrop for a reception that transcended into the party of the year.

Family played a central role in Katherine and Nick’s celebration, with their siblings and nieces and nephews standing by their side as part of the 27-person wedding party. Pink, the signature color, transformed the venue into a romantic candle-lit garden, with shades of pink, blush, and cream flowers throughout.

Katherine’s vision for her wedding included three must-haves, each adding a unique touch to the festivities. The gold dance floor, set beneath the crystal chandelier, provided the perfect stage for their first dance as husband and wife. The band “N’ Demand” kept the energy high throughout the night, ensuring that every guest was on their feet and dancing the night away. And capturing the magic of the moment, live wedding artist Greg Kalamar immortalized Katherine and Nick’s first dance with a gorgeous painting, a cherished memento of their wedding day.

Beyond the exquisite details, what truly made Katherine and Nick’s wedding memorable was the warmth and love that radiated from every moment. Their genuine kindness and family-centric approach infused the celebration with an undeniable sense of joy and camaraderie, creating memories for them and their families to last a life-time.

In the end, Katherine and Nick’s wedding was a beautiful fusion of tradition, elegance, and heartfelt celebration—a true reflection of their love and the journey they’ve embarked upon together.
